Abstract
The aim of this work was to develop a superconducting laboratory magnet system producing an AC magnetic field up to 50 Hz superimposed on the bias DC magnetic field. Such a system is required for the studies of some properties of the both conventional and high T c superconductors. The minimum desired parameters of the system are: • - AC magnetic field amplitude: B AC=0,6 T at 50 Hz and B DC=0 B AC=0,25 T at 50 Hz and B DC=3 T • - low total losses. We have designed, constructed and tested 2 different systems: the simple coaxial coil system and the coaxial coil system with strongly reduced coupling between the AC and DC magnet.
